My DD had to be taken to A and E today, long story but she had a fever, seemed in pain etc. Anyway the first urine sample they took showed possible infection but the Dr felt it was because the sample was contaminated so we got a clear catch sample and he said all was fine, a bit of protein but no infection, she probably has a virus. So I just wondered if anyone can tell me what it means that she had protein in her urine? Fighting a virus?

many people spill a little protein into their urine when they are sick. it's usually quite normal and spilling should stop soon with no ill effects at all. hope she feels better soon

missorinoco · 19/06/2008 22:50

you can protein in the urine in the context of a fever. it's not unusual.
